  • Both video cards are using PCIe 3.0 x16 interface connection to a motherboard.
  • Tesla M60 has 4 GB more memory, than Radeon R9 M365X.
  • Radeon R9 M365X is used in Laptops, and Tesla M60 - in Desktops.
  • Radeon R9 M365X is build with GCN architecture, and Tesla M60 - with Maxwell 2.0.
  • Core clock speed of Radeon R9 M365X is 343 MHz higher, than Tesla M60.
  • Radeon R9 M365X and Tesla M60 are manufactured by 28 nm process technology.
  • Memory clock speed of Tesla M60 is 3887 MHz higher, than Radeon R9 M365X.
